pattern
Prononciation : [/ˈpætɚn/]
Mot
Contexte : « design »
(noun) a repeated decorative design or motif. It is like a design that is used over and over again to make something look pretty.
Exemple
The tablecloth had a floral pattern that matched the curtains.
Exemple
The plain white wall had no pattern on it.
Exemple
What pattern is on your favorite shirt?
Contexte : « behavior »
(noun) a regular and repeated way of doing something. It is like a way of behaving that happens the same way every time.
Exemple
She noticed a pattern in his behavior that indicated he was nervous.
Exemple
There was no pattern to the way the leaves fell from the tree.
Exemple
Can you find a pattern in the numbers on the clock?
Contexte : « form »
(verb) to make or design something using a repeated decorative design. It is like creating a design that repeats itself to give something a pretty look.
Exemple
She patterned the quilt with a floral design.
Exemple
He preferred to leave the walls plain and not patterned.
Exemple
How will you pattern the tablecloth for the party?
